chrome扩展popup.js无效

时间:2013-02-09 04:52:15

标签: jquery google-chrome google-chrome-extension

我有一个看起来像这样的popup.html

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d">
<html>
<head>
    <link type="text/css" rel="stylesheet" href="css/fbh-ui.css" />
    <script type="text/javascript" src="js/jq.js"></script>
    <script type="text/javascript" src="js/fbh-popup.js"></script>
</head>

<body style="width: 200px">
    <div id="fbh-main">
        <div id="fbh-popup-enabled"></div>
    </div>
</body>

fbh-popup.js看起来像这样

$('#fbh-popup-enabled').html('test');

JS应该改变div的内容,但不会。我甚至在JS文件中尝试了一个简单的console.log('test')并且没有触发。我很茫然。

1 个答案:

答案 0 :(得分:0)

您必须在ready event callback

中编写代码
$(document).ready(function() {
  $('#fbh-popup-enabled').html('test');
});